Q. How do I take care of my 8mm & Super8 film and how can I tell if they're deteriating?
A . Cleaning your film is vital to the life of your movies. If
you see a powder-like residue or smell something that resembles
vinegar, it's probably mold, and has already begun to break down the
film, deteriating it. All reels should be kept in a cool dry
place, at a temperature of about 75 degrees F. There is a reel cleaning solution that can be ordered online, or you can use regular ole pledge, a household staple.
